Bear River hasn't had much luck against Box Elder recently, but that could start to change on Saturday. The Bears will take on the Bees at 9:00 a.m. Both come into the matchup bolstered by wins in their previous matches.
Bear River played in-conference for the first time on Thursday and got just the result they were looking for. They came out on top against Deseret Peak by a score of 3-1. The win made it back-to-back victories for the Bears.
Bear River had a slow start but a hot finish: after dropping the first set, they turned around to win the next three. The final score came out to 23-25, 25-15, 25-21, 25-19.
Meanwhile, Box Elder made easy work of Northridge on Thursday and carried off a 3-0 victory. The win continues a trend for the Bees in their matchups with the Knights: they've now won five in a row.
Box Elder not only won, but also showed off some consistency: they kept Northridge between 14 and 16 points across their sets. The match finished with set scores of 25-14, 25-14, 25-16.
Bear River's record now sits at 4-10. As for Box Elder, their record is now 8-1.
Bear River suffered a grim 3-0 defeat to Box Elder when the teams last played on March 3rd. Can the Bears avenge their loss or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
